WebSep 30, 2024 · Orange Shirt Day, which takes place Sept. 30, is an annual event that honours the survivors of residential schools and their families. WebSep 24, 2024 · “Young Phyllis was wearing a brand new orange shirt for her first day of school — new clothes being a rare and wonderful thing for a First Nation girl growing up in her grandmother’s care — but the Mission Oblates quickly stripped her of her new shirt and replaced it with the school’s institutional uniform (Indigenous Corporate Training Inc.).” WebSep 24, 2024 · “Orange Shirt Day is a movement that officially began in 2013, but in reality, it began in 1973 when six-year-old Phyllis Webstad entered the St. Joseph Mission …
